Surcharges
Surcharges are additional fees or charges added to the cost of a good or service, often to cover increases in operational costs or to provide additional services.
Reciprocity Agreement
An agreement between two parties to provide similar benefits or services to each other, often found in trade and partnership contexts.
List Price
The suggested retail price set by a manufacturer or retailer for a product, often not reflecting discounts or promotions.
Allowances
Financial or material provisions made to cover a specific need, expense, or reduction in price.
